Plagiarism checker is a new software program. It’s purpose is to review specific text that is entered in to it. This software will search data bases for exact and near exact matches in wording. If matches can be found, the assumption will be that the writer stole material in the form of ideas and/or the written word. Laws exist to protect original material and to prosecute those who steal it .
